vaschy-clutch-bag-for-women-soft-leather-wristlet-wallet-cell-phone-rivet-cross-body-for-women-with-card-slots-ladies-handbags-shoulder-bags-purse-with-detachable-strap-black-5991.jpgHow to Sell Designer Handbags to Sell Quickly and For the Best Price

Designer bags like the Hermes Birkin have a great resale value. They are highly sought-after for their design and craftsmanship and also for their brand reputation.

Direct sale or consignment are two options for selling designer handbags online. Direct sale enables the seller to keep a larger proportion of the sale price.

Selling consignment items to a consignment shop cuts down on the work and transaction risks of proving authenticity, determining price and dealing with buyers.

When choosing an online platform to purchase from, you should consider several important aspects:

How many customers will be able view and buy your bags? Credibility and trust: Does the platform have a positive reputation among its users? Security of transactions: Does the site provide secure and convenient payment methods?

Seller fees: Some sites charge a flat rate for listing your products, while others take part of the sale. If you want to maximize your profits, it is recommended to select a site that charges low fees to sellers.

Resellers

There are numerous resellers who purchase designer handbags and then sell them for a profit. These firms have higher profit margins and can sell your handbag in a shorter period of time than consignment stores. It is recommended to conduct some research about the business to make sure they are reputable, and will take good care of your bag. You should also be prepared to bargain with a seller, since they might want to get the highest price for your bag.

Some of the most popular resellers include The RealReal, Fashionphile and Vestiaire Collective. They have high standards for the brands they accept and will typically only take bags in excellent condition. They will also usually offer a fair price based on the brand and condition of your bag. If you choose to sell your bag through one of these companies ensure that you capture well-lit and detailed photos. A lot of these companies require that you create a video about the bag, as this can aid in attracting buyers.

eBay

If you are looking to sell your designer bag online, eBay is a great alternative. The site offers a large market, as well as easy listing and delivery options. Additionally, it lets sellers set their prices and pay a small fee for selling. Then, list your designer bag in a category that reflects its worth. For example, "luxury preowned." Include lots of photos and a thorough description of the condition the bag.
